As many as half a million Portuguese protested in Lisbon, on Saturday.
Hundreds of thousands more protested in cities and towns across the country.
They marched through the streets to let the government know their anger over austerity measures.
Taxes have gone up as the government tries to bring an end to the country's deficit.
Unemployment is closing in on eighteen percent as Portugal is in it's third year of recession.
The protests have the backing of most of the major union organizations.
